Capital Investment Proposal
A formal request or plan for spending on large-scale projects or purchases, intended to improve a company's assets or operations.
Internal Rate of Return Method
A financial metric used to evaluate the profitability of potential investments, calculating the discount rate that makes the net present value of all cash flows from a particular project equal to zero.
Average Annual Income
The average amount of money earned per year over a specified period, often used to assess financial stability.
Accounting Rate of Return
A financial metric used to assess the profitability of an investment, calculated by dividing the average annual accounting profit by the initial investment cost.
